R can be used to find the probability of obtaining a given F value or one more extreme (calculates the area under the curve to the left of the value). The function requires the F* test statistic, the degrees of freedom for the numerator and the degrees of freedom for the denominator (entered in that order). For our example, we will use F* = 2.19, dfbetween 5 and dfwithin = 54. Then the p-value is: 1-pf (2.19, df1-5, df2=54) Enter this code into RStudio to confirm you obtain the value 0.06871.
